EOS Coin is the native cryptocurrency of the EOS blockchain platform, which is designed to provide a decentralized operating system for the development of smart contracts and decentralized applications (dApps). EOS aims to address the scalability issues faced by earlier blockchain platforms like Bitcoin and Ethereum, offering faster and more efficient transaction processing.
The EOS platform was developed by Block.one, a technology company, and is often described as a “blockchain 3.0” solution due to its focus on speed, scalability, and usability. By eliminating the need for traditional mining, EOS utilizes a Delegated Proof of Stake (DPoS) consensus mechanism to enhance transaction speed and reduce latency, making it a suitable platform for high-performance dApps.
EOS Coin works on the EOS blockchain, which uses a Delegated Proof of Stake (DPoS) consensus model. This model allows token holders to vote for block producers, who validate transactions and produce blocks. The primary goal of the EOS blockchain is to support decentralized applications that require high throughput and minimal transaction fees.
1. Scalability and Speed:
EOS is designed to support large-scale dApps with the ability to process thousands of transactions per second (TPS), making it one of the fastest blockchain platforms. Unlike Ethereum, which faces high gas fees during network congestion, EOS offers almost zero transaction fees and faster processing speeds.
2. Delegated Proof of Stake (DPoS):
EOS uses DPoS instead of the traditional Proof of Work (PoW) or Proof of Stake (PoS) consensus models. This means that token holders vote for block producers (similar to miners), who are responsible for validating transactions and securing the network. This method allows EOS to achieve high scalability without compromising on decentralization.
3. Decentralized Applications (dApps):
EOS enables the creation of dApps, which can be used for a wide variety of purposes, from gaming and finance to social media and entertainment. Developers can use EOS to build dApps without worrying about scalability or high fees, offering a user-friendly experience.
4. Resource Allocation:
EOS Coin is also used to stake resources on the network, allowing users to access the bandwidth, CPU, and storage required for running dApps. The more EOS tokens a user holds, the more resources they can access, which contributes to a better overall network performance.
